;*********************************************************************** | |
; Function Name : loader_init1 | |
; Description : Initialize sysytem by loader program | |
; Arguments : none | |
; Return Value : none | |
;*********************************************************************** | |
loader_init1: | |
stack_init: | |
; Stack setting | |
cps #17 ; FIQ mode | |
ldr sp, =SFE(FIQ_STACK) | |
cps #18 ; IRQ mode | |
ldr sp, =SFE(IRQ_STACK) | |
cps #23 ; Abort mode | |
ldr sp, =SFE(ABT_STACK) | |
cps #27 ; Undef mode | |
ldr sp, =SFE(UND_STACK) | |
cps #31 ; System mode | |
ldr sp, =SFE(CSTACK) | |
cps #19 ; SVC mode | |
ldr sp, =SFE(SVC_STACK) | |
vfp_init: | |
; Initialize VFP setting | |
mrc p15, #0, r0, c1, c0, #2 ; Enables cp10 and cp11 accessing | |
orr r0, r0, #0xF00000 | |
mcr p15, #0, r0, c1, c0, #2 | |
isb ; Ensuring Context-changing | |
mov r0, #0x40000000 ; Enables VFP operation | |
vmsr fpexc, r0 | |
data_init: | |
; Initialize variables has initialized value of loader_init2. | |
; Variables has no initialized value already be initialized to zero | |
; in boot sequence(Clear ATCM and BTCM). | |
ldr r0, =SFB(LDR_DATA_RBLOCK) | |
ldr r1, =SFB(LDR_DATA_WBLOCK) | |
ldr r2, =SIZEOF(LDR_DATA_WBLOCK) | |
cmp r2, #0 | |
#ifdef DUAL_CORE | |
beq m3_init | |
#else | |
beq jump_loader_init2 | |
#endif | |
copy_to_LDR_DATA: | |
ldrb r3, [r0], #1 | |
strb r3, [r1], #1 | |
subs r2, r2, #1 | |
bne copy_to_LDR_DATA | |
dsb ; Ensuring data-changing | |
#ifdef DUAL_CORE | |
m3_init: | |
; Initialize image for Cortex-M3 core | |
ldr r0, =SFB(M3_PRG_RBLOCK) | |
ldr r1, =SFB(M3_PRG_WBLOCK) | |
ldr r2, =SIZEOF(M3_PRG_WBLOCK) | |
cmp r2, #0 | |
beq jump_loader_init2 | |
copy_to_M3_PRG: | |
ldrb r3, [r0], #1 | |
strb r3, [r1], #1 | |
subs r2, r2, #1 | |
bne copy_to_M3_PRG | |
dsb ; Ensuring data-changing | |
#endif | |
; Jump to loader_init2 | |
jump_loader_init2: | |
ldr r0, =loader_init2 | |
bx r0 | |

;*********************************************************************** | |
; Function Name : mpu_init | |
; Description : Initialize MPU settings | |
; Arguments : none | |
; Return Value : none | |
;*********************************************************************** | |
mpu_init: | |
; RGNR(MPU Memory Region Number Register) | |
mcr p15, #0, r0, c6, c2, #0 | |
isb ; Ensuring Context-changing | |
; DRBAR(Data Region Base Address Register) | |
mcr p15, #0, r1, c6, c1, #0 | |
isb ; Ensuring Context-changing | |
; DRACR(Data Region Access Control Register) | |
mcr p15, #0, r2, c6, c1, #4 | |
isb ; Ensuring Context-changing | |
; DRSR(Data Region Size and Enable Register) | |
mcr p15, #0, r3, c6, c1, #2 | |
isb ; Ensuring Context-changing | |
bx lr | |
